Influence of natural vegetation on wetland soil development in the Yellow River Delta
1, promoting soil fertility: natural vegetation can decompose a lot of organic matter and can be used as fertilizer to improve soil fertility.
2. Improve soil structure: Natural vegetation can combine with soil to form a complete soil structure, which makes soil have good permeability and water storage capacity.
3. Prevention of weathering: Natural vegetation can prevent weathering and soil erosion.
4. Reduce water loss: Natural vegetation can reduce water loss and maintain soil moisture.
5. Regulate the climate: Natural vegetation can absorb a lot of heat and release it into the air, thus regulating the climate.
6. Absorb pollutants: Natural vegetation can absorb a lot of harmful substances, such as sulfur dioxide and nitrogen oxides, and reduce environmental pollution.
